Further details about the role
The Headteacher and Governors are looking for a committed and motivated Teaching Assistant to join our team. The Teaching Assistant will provide support a child with complex needs. The role will involve working with the teacher to plan and deliver activities, assessing assessibility and adapting tasks as necessary. The role will also include supporting the pupil with routines, transitions, social and emotional development, sensory breaks, communication skills and behaviour management.
The position is for a fixed term up to July 2023 but is likely to afford opportunities to become permanent, depending on the needs of the pupils next year.
